Job Description - Sr. Human Resources Manager

Sr. Human Resources Manager


Location: Brooklyn, NY
Schedule: Full-Time
Salary: $90,000- $120,000


About MedElite


Since 2011, MedElite has been dedicated to improving the standard of care in skilled nursing and long-term care facilities nationwide. We implement a data-driven, "treat in place" model that enhances resident health outcomes while saving valuable time and resources for our partner organizations. By managing a network of advanced practice providers and specialty clinicians, we deliver high-quality, proactive care directly to the bedside. Our passion for positively impacting the lives of residents, administrators, and healthcare professionals drives our commitment to continuously innovate and redefine senior care across the country.


Job Summary


We are seeking an experienced and highly motivated Sr. Human Resources Manager to serve as the primary Human Resources point of contact for all New York employees and managers. This role oversees employee relations, leave administration, onboarding, policy communication, compliance, and day-to-day HR operations. The Sr. Human Resources Manager must be detail-oriented, proactive, and able to navigate sensitive matters with professionalism and discretion. The ideal candidate brings strong knowledge of New York employment laws, exceptional communication skills, and the ability to build trusted relationships across all levels of the organization.


Responsibilities


Employee Relations



  • Serve as the main HR point of contact for all New York employees and managers.

  • Respond to HR inquiries, provide guidance on policies, and support day-to-day employee needs.

  • Manage employee relations issues, including conflict resolution, coaching managers, conducting investigations, and handling disciplinary actions or terminations.


Leave & Accommodation Management



  • Process and track all leaves, including FMLA, New York Paid Family Leave (NYPFL), ADA accommodations, and workers’ compensation.

  • Maintain accurate documentation and ensure full compliance with state and federal requirements.


Training & Compliance



  • Coordinate and/or deliver mandatory training (anti-harassment, Code of Conduct, HIPAA refresher, safety).

  • Maintain audit-ready personnel files, I-9s, licenses, background checks, and compliance documentation.

  • Support internal and external HR audits in partnership with the HR Director.


Onboarding & Offboarding



  • Facilitate new hire onboarding for New York employees to ensure a smooth and compliant start.

  • Manage offboarding tasks including exit documentation, equipment retrieval, and system access updates.


Policies & Employee Communication



  • Update HR policies and the employee handbook as needed.

  • Communicate policy changes clearly and ensure organizational understanding and compliance.


Benefits, Payroll & Reporting



  • Assist with benefits questions, open enrollment processes, and basic payroll inquiries.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ve payroll-related issues in a timely manner.

  • Run monthly and quarterly HR reports, including headcount, turnover, compliance items, and other metrics.


Partnership & Projects



  • Collaborate with the HR Director on employee engagement surveys, compliance reviews, and special ad-hoc HR initiatives.

  • Contribute to improving HR processes, supporting culture initiatives, and enhancing the employee experience.


Requirements



  • 5–7 years of HR Generalist or HR Manager experience; New York HR experience strongly preferred.

  • Strong understanding of federal, state, and NYC employment laws.

  • Experience managing employee relations investigations and leave administration.

  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ills.

  • Highly organized with strong attention to detail and the ability to handle confidential information.

  • Proficiency with HRIS systems and Microsoft Office Suite.

  • Must be able to lift a minimum of 20 pounds and stand / walk / work on your feet up to 6-8 hours per day
